At the quarter mark of the season, Kareem Hunt is on pace to break the single-season scrimmage-yards mark as a rookie.

Hunt has 659 yards from scrimmage through four games, which puts him on pace for 2,636 yards. Chris Johnson set the NFL record with 2,509 yards in 2009.

Hunt is also on pace for 2,008 rushing yards, which would top Eric Dickerson's rookie record of 1,808 yards.
